Manchester United 'were willing to pay £45m for Moussa Diaby over summer'

Bayer Leverkusen's Moussa Diaby pictured in March 2020© Reuters

Manchester United were reportedly prepared to pay up to €50m (£45m) to sign Bayer Leverkusen attacker Moussa Diaby during the summer transfer window.

The 21-year-old enjoyed a productive 2019-20 campaign for Leverkusen, scoring eight times and contributing eight assists in 39 appearances in all competitions.

According to Bild, United identified Diaby as a possible transfer target over the summer, and the 20-time English champions were prepared to pay as much as €50m (£45m) to sign him.

However, the report claims that Leverkusen signalled that they were not prepared to sell the France Under-21 international due to his importance to the side.

Diaby, who has scored twice and registered one assist in nine outings at club level this term, has also previously been linked with Arsenal and Borussia Dortmund.

The left-sided attacker arrived at BayArena from Paris Saint-Germain in July 2019.



Report: AC Milan to battle Arsenal for Red Bull Salzburg star Dominik Szoboszlai

Red Bull Salzburg midfielder Dominik Szoboszlai pictured ahead of a Champions League match in November 2019© Reuters

Arsenal face strong competition from AC Milan for Red Bull Salzburg attacking midfielder Dominik Szoboszlai, according to a report.

The Hungary international was repeatedly linked with a move to the Emirates Stadium in the summer on the back of an impressive 2019-20 campaign.

Szoboszlai has picked up from where he left off last term by scoring five times and providing seven assists in 10 appearances in all competitions.

Arsenal are believed to still be interested in signing the 20-year-old, but Gazzetta dello Sport claims that Milan are also desperate to strike a deal.

The Italian giants are said to have already had a couple of bids knocked back in the past for Szoboszlai, but they may now return with the €25m (£22.56m) offer that Salzburg are after.

RB Leipzig have also been tipped to move for Szoboszlai when the transfer window reopens in January.
